This repository contains an Automatic re-synchronization Controller Model Implementation. These Modelica-compliant models are briefly described in the following paper of the American Modelica Conference 2018:
Biswarup Mukherjee and Luigi Vanfretti, "Modeling of PMU-Based Automatic Re-synchronization Controls for DER Generators in Power Distribution Networks using Modelica language," Proceedings of the 13th International Modelica Conference, Regensburg, Germany, March 4–6, 2019. [http://dx.doi.org/10.3384/ecp19157607]
In your favorite Modelica tool, e.g. Open Modelica, follow the steps below:
- File/Open
./package.mo - Under the main package
Modelica2019Germany_ResynchOperation, Six subpackages should appear as: (1)Controls, (2)Generators, (3)SimulationSetup, (4)Essentials, (5)PowerFlowData, (6)Network. It is recommended to use the distributed version of OpenIPSL library package (version: 1.0.0) from this repository. - Under the
Networksubpackage, go to the modelNetwork_10MW; the Modelica implementation of the distribution network generator model is shown above including the Automatic Re-synchronization controller. - Go to the
Simulationtab of your tool, and click theSimulatebutton. - The simulaiton results of the transmission and distribution network bus voltages should be similar to the figure shown below:
- You can perform similar simulations of the power system model by making your own changes using other components from the distributed package 'Modelica2019Germany_ResynchOperation.mo'.
